TORY BURCH OPENS FESTIVE POP-UP
12.10.19
Tory Burch is celebrating the holiday season with a unique interactive experience at South Coast Plaza in Costa Mesa beginning on December 11. Inspired by Tory’s love of color, the brand has built a festive pop-up in the shopping center’s carousel court— a short walk from the Tory Burch boutique.
Located on the Mall’s second floor, the pop-up installation will invite guests to experience the colorful world of Tory Burch, with bold décor as well as colorful products—from cozy, color-blocked sweaters to brightly hued handbags.
The centerpiece of the installation will be a vibrant, retro-inspired color wheel game; guests will drop a round color chip down the pegged wheel, winning whatever prize corresponds with the slot where the chip lands. Exclusive prizes range from gift cards to Lee Radziwill handbags.
The Tory Burch In Color interactive experience will be open through December 24.
Open 10 a.m. to 9 p.m. Monday through Friday; 10 a.m. to 8 p.m. Saturday; and 11 a.m. o 6:30 p.m. Sunday.

Laguna BEach Books and YOung Company Book Drive
12.10.19
Laguna Beach Books and Young Company are sponsoring a Book Drive through Dec. 21. Gently used children's picture books can be dropped off at Laguna Beach Books. Donate a book or check-in on Facebook at the bookstore and enter to win a raffle for a $50 gift card to Laguna Beach Books.
Don't have any books to donate? Laguna Beach Books staff can recommend books to be purchased for the book drive. Books will be donated to Orange County United Way's Early Literacy program.
